Abstract
An observation data screening unit (103) executes least squares method positioning using, as an observation amount, n (n is an integer of 3 or larger) number of single difference amounts of an L1-wave pseudorange obtained from n pieces of observation data from n number of positioning satellites and n pieces of correction data corresponding to the n pieces of the observation data. The observation data screening unit (103) calculates a sum of squares of n residuals obtained for each positioning satellite by executing the least squares method positioning and normalizes the n residuals. The observation data screening unit (103) then evaluates the sum of squares of the residuals and the n normalized residuals.
